The Department of Electrical Engineering offers undergraduate and graduate programs that meet the needs of industry in the design of electrical, electronic, photonic and computer systems as well as their components. These programs are oriented towards computer systems, telecommunications, digital processing, industrial control, energy transport, vision and microelectronics. Faculty members lead numerous research projects, several of which are in close collaboration with industry, essentially around three major areas: power electronics and industrial control, telecommunications and microelectronics, and the field of imaging, vision and artificial intelligence.

The ÉTS Department of Electrical Engineering is looking for professors with basic training in engineering and an expertise related to transport electrification. Research and teaching activities of the selected candidates will join those already in place in the Department of Electrical Engineering.

Areas of expertise sought:

Applications are sought in the field of transport electrification. More specifically, the person sought must have one or other of the following sub-areas of expertise:

  • Magnetic systems for transmission / clutch / braking / suspension

  • Power management

  • Wireless charging

  • Other related topic relevant to the main subject area
